Excelerate, do you know if progress or anybody else has stronger end links for the TL? I'm hearing stories of the oem end links popping out (then making clunking noises) due to the higher stresses from this beefier stock bar, especially on lowered suspensions.

clunk noises are usually due to poor lubrication on the sway bar bushings...

Just get greasable energy suspension bushings... or re-lub the sway bar bushings every few months...

Josh,,
FYI the RSB is really tight on the 2nd gen. I wouldn't recommend it for 2nd gen apps. Trancemission helped me put it on yesterday, and the anchor/Bushings don't sit perfectly straight as they did on the OEM RSB.

Thought I would give you some feedback. however, it drives like a dream with the new RSB. Just wondering if the Bushings will end up failing sooner due to the way it needed to be installed.
